    Otto Addo vows to secure win against Madagascar

    The head coach of the Black Stars of Ghana, Otto Addo has noted that his team will do everything to secure victory against Madagascar in their next game of the qualifiers for the 2026 FIFA World Cup.

    Ghana will play away to Madagascar on Monday, March 24, in Round 6 of the African qualifiers for the 2026 World Cup.

    The Black Stars will be heading into the clash as Group I leaders following their thumping 5-0 win against Chad on Friday night at the Accra Sports Stadium.

    Having secured the top spot in the group, coach Otto Addo insists that his side must do everything to hold onto it.

    “It’s always easier when you’re on top. We want to stay there. We will try to do everything to beat Madagascar on Monday to keep the top spot,” the Ghana coach stressed.

    A win for the Black Stars on Monday will be crucial for Coach Otto Addo’s side, ensuring that they improve their chances of qualifying for the 2026 FIFA World Cup.

    Madagascar, only trailing Ghana by two points in the Group I standings will also be keen on earning the three points to retake the top spot.
